An award winning defense trial firm, Adams & Boswell, a Professional Corporation, was founded in 1985. Adams & Boswell concentrates its practice in the areas of insurance and corporate defense. Members of the firm have tried hundreds of personal injury and insurance coverage cases in the state and federal courts of East and Southeast Texas, including Beaumont, Dallas, Galveston, and Houston, and the firm also handles cases in Western Louisiana. The firm routinely handles appeals in the Texas and federal appellate courts.
The firm's primary practice includes personal injury defense, products' liability, toxic tort, admiralty, medical malpractice, intellectual property and technology law, Superfund and hazardous waste, commercial, construction, governmental liability, automobile, premises liability, and general litigation defense. The firm also has significant experience in the area of insurance coverage and bad faith litigation, and governmental relations. The firm represents businesses and individuals in their commercial transactions.
Four of the firm's attorneys, Kent Adams, John Boswell, Glenn Heubner, and Russ Heald are Board Certified in Personal Injury Trial Law by the Texas Board of Legal Specialization. Mr. Heald is also Board Certified in Civil Trial Law by the Texas Board of Legal Specialization. All four are rated “AV” by Martindale Hubbell. Kent Adams successfully tried the Bryant and Shackelford toxic tort cases in 2002, winning a defense verdict that was recognized by the National Law Journal as one of the “Top Ten Defense Verdicts in the United States in 2002”. Adams & Boswell, P. C., has handled the defense of numerous multi-plaintiff and multi-defendant toxic tort, hazardous waste, and Superfund cases.
